ASSOCIATIONS INCORPORATION ACT 1985 - SECT 32

32—Voting on a contract in which a committee member has an interest

        (1)         A member of the committee of an incorporated association who has any direct or indirect pecuniary interest in a contract, or proposed contract, with the association must not take part in any decision of the committee with respect to that contract (but may, subject to complying with the provisions of this Division, take part in any deliberations with respect to that contract).

Maximum penalty: $5 000.

        (2)         Subsection (1) does not apply in respect of a pecuniary interest—

            (a)         that exists only by virtue of the fact that the member of the committee is a member of a class of persons for whose benefit the association is established; or

            (b)         that the member of the committee has in common with all or a substantial proportion of the members of the association.
